Leyther_Matt Posted July 20, 2019 Share Posted July 20, 2019 3 minutes ago, Casino said: Dunno much about this, but I'd guess any credit card company would have to authorise BWFCFV to receive funds Is that likely within 2 weeks? I think its cash, cash, cash It’s not the credit card company as such, more the card processors - the likes of Verifone take a good few weeks to set up with a new company because of fears of money laundering and the like. Best hope is that they already put that in place in January but it’s unlikely. Same is likely to apply to Direct Debits as well unless V12 fancied taking the risk (Zebra have gone bump who the club have used previously). RoadRunnerFan Posted July 20, 2019 Share Posted July 20, 2019 (edited) 57 minutes ago, Leyther_Matt said: What’s the craic with that if we started the season but didn’t finish it? I normally pay in full on credit card for our three season tickets and would rather do so again so that the club has the cash flow, but the direct debit thing makes sense to me to get some money back if the worst happened. Make a claim under Section 75 of the consumer credit act. There are template claim letters on Which, Martin Lewis references it a lot too. There is a recent article in the Nottingham Post advising Notts County fans to buy theirs on credit cards. Edit - just checked with my Bradford mate.[ 20/07, 18:09] a Mike, Did I imagine it or did you claim a season ticket refund through credit card law protection when Bradford had an insolvency event. (Asking for a friend 😗) [20/07, 18:13] Mike Taylor: I personally didn’t but knew people who did, I voted with 800 others for the CVA as we were collectively a major creditor at the time but I knew some who claimed the cc refund (approx £3k for a 25 year ticket) before exiting admin and into a new company or however it works...
